What companies run services between The Shard, England and Greenwich Park, England?

Southeastern operates a train from London Bridge to Maze Hill every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£2–5 and the journey takes 10 min. Thameslink also services this route hourly. Alternatively, Stagecoach London operates a bus from London Bridge Station to Greenwich High Road / Royal Hill h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 28 min.
